    Clostridium difficile Infection and Proton Pump Inhibitor Use in Hospitalized Pediatric Cystic Fibrosis Patients

    Children with cystic fibrosis (CF) often take proton pump inhibitors (PPIs), which helps improve efficacy of fat absorption with pancreatic enzyme replacement therapy. However, PPI use is known to be associated with Clostridium difficile-(C. diff-) associated diarrhea (CDAD). We retrospectively evaluated the incidence of C. diff infection from all pediatric hospital admissions over a 5-year period at a single tertiary children's hospital. We found significantly more C. diff-positive stool tests in hospitalized patients with CF compared to patients with no diagnosis of CF. However, use of a PPI was not associated with an increased risk of CDAD in hospitalized CF patients. In summary, C. diff infection is more common in hospitalized pediatric CF patients although PPI use may not be a risk factor for CDAD development in this patient population

    Prospective multicenter randomized patient recruitment and sample collection to enable future measurements of sputum biomarkers of inflammation in an observational study of cystic fibrosis.

    BACKGROUND: Biomarkers of inflammation predictive of cystic fibrosis (CF) disease outcomes would increase the power of clinical trials and contribute to better personalization of clinical assessments. A representative patient cohort would improve searching for believable, generalizable, reproducible and accurate biomarkers. METHODS: We recruited patients from Mountain West CF Consortium (MWCFC) care centers for prospective observational study of sputum biomarkers of inflammation. After informed consent, centers enrolled randomly selected patients with CF who were clinically stable sputum producers, 12 years of age and older, without previous organ transplantation. RESULTS: From December 8, 2014 through January 16, 2016, we enrolled 114 patients (53 male) with CF with continuing data collection. Baseline characteristics included mean age 27 years (SD = 12), 80% predicted forced expiratory volume in 1 s (SD = 23%), 1.0 prior year pulmonary exacerbations (SD = 1.2), home elevation 328 m (SD = 112) above sea level. Compared with other patients in the US CF Foundation Patient Registry (CFFPR) in 2014, MWCFC patients had similar distribution of sex, age, lung function, weight and rates of exacerbations, diabetes, pancreatic insufficiency, CF-related arthropathy and airway infections including methicillin-sensitive or -resistant Staphylococcus aureus, Pseudomonas aeruginosa, Burkholderia cepacia complex, fungal and non-tuberculous Mycobacteria infections. They received CF-specific treatments at similar frequencies. CONCLUSIONS: Randomly-selected, sputum-producing patients within the MWCFC represent sputum-producing patients in the CFFPR. They have similar characteristics, lung function and frequencies of pulmonary exacerbations, microbial infections and use of CF-specific treatments. These findings will plausibly make future interpretations of quantitative measurements of inflammatory biomarkers generalizable to sputum-producing patients in the CFFPR

    High dose intermittent ticarcillin–clavulanate administration in pediatric cystic fibrosis patients

    AbstractBackgroundThe Intermountain Cystic Fibrosis Pediatric Center utilizes ticarcillin–clavulanate 400mg/kg/day divided every 6h, (maximum 24g/day). This dosing strategy is higher than the Cystic Fibrosis Foundation (CFF) recommendations and the Food and Drug Administration (FDA) approved package labeling. The purpose is to determine the safety of this dosing regimen.MethodsA retrospective study of pediatric cystic fibrosis (CF) patients admitted from January 1, 2005 to December 31, 2009 who received the dosing regimen for at least 7days. Baseline and follow-up laboratory parameters were recorded. Statistical analysis was performed.Results127 patients met inclusion criteria. The mean (±SD) ticarcillin dose was 3.5g (±2.16) every 6h; while the mean (±SD) total ticarcillin dose was 13.5g (±6.5) per day. No significant differences occurred in liver function tests, white blood count, and platelet count from baseline. Serum creatinine showed a statistically significant decrease from baseline.ConclusionsHigher than FDA approved doses of ticarcillin–clavulanate may be safely used in the treatment of exacerbations in pediatric cystic fibrosis patients

    A Computer-Based Instructional Management System for General Psychology

    We describe the development and impact of a minicomputer-based system of instructional management for the General Psychology program at Texas Tech University. We also discuss ways that such a program might be useful in other university settings and in stimulating research concerning the educational process

    HPV status of oropharyngeal cancer by combination HPV DNA/p16 testing: biological relevance of discordant results

    Background and Purpose. Human papillomavirus (HPV) causes up to 70 % of oropharyngeal cancers (OSCC). HPV positive OSCC has a more favorable outcome, thus HPV status is being used to guide treatment and predict outcome. Combination HPV DNA/p16(ink4) (p16) testing is commonly used for HPV status, but there are no standardized methods, scoring or interpretative criteria. The significance of discordant (HPV DNA positive/p16 negative and HPV DNA negative/p16 positive) cancers is controversial. In this study, 647 OSCCs from 10 Australian centers were tested for HPV DNA/p16 expression. Our aims are to determine p16 distribution by HPV DNA status to inform decisions on p16 scoring and to assess clinical significance of discordant cancers.Methods.
